The Truth Behind Likewize – A Detailed Look Into Customer Experiences

When considering trading in your Apple devices, its crucial to conduct thorough research on the company you choose to work with. One such company that has been under scrutiny is Likewize, a trade-in platform affiliated with Apple. We have gathered a collection of English comments from individuals who have had experiences with Likewize, shedding light on their encounters with the company.

Deceptive Valuations and Disappointing Offers

  1. One user expressed feeling misled after being offered £190 for an iPhone 11 Pro, only to find out it was valued at £0 due to a chipped screen.
  2. Another individual was quoted £110 for their iPad, which was later valued at £0 due to LCD display burn-in, a claim they rejected.
  3. Multiple users reported significant drops in trade-in values upon inspection of their devices, leading to frustration and distrust towards the company.

Questionable Practices and Lack of Transparency

  • Customers have raised concerns about Likewizes lack of communication throughout the trade-in process, with delays and discrepancies in valuation offers.
  • Instances of devices being returned with unexplained damages, such as scratches and dirt marks, have left users questioning the integrity of Likewizes evaluation procedures.
  • Several users have highlighted discrepancies between the condition of their devices and the reasons provided by Likewize for reduced trade-in values, suggesting possible inaccuracies in their assessments.

Recommendations and Lessons Learned

Based on the feedback shared by individuals who have interacted with Likewize, here are some key takeaways:

  1. Document the condition of your device thoroughly before sending it for a trade-in, including photos and videos, to support any potential disputes.
  2. Consider alternative trade-in options, such as in-person evaluations at Apple stores, to ensure a more transparent and reliable assessment of your device.
  3. Exercise caution and diligence when engaging with online trade-in platforms, and be wary of offers that seem too good to be true.

Can you provide an overview of the typical trade-in process with Trade In-platform?

Trade In-platform offers customers the opportunity to trade in their electronics, such as smartphones and tablets, in exchange for credit or cash. Customers typically receive a quote for their device online, send in their device using provided packaging, and then await an evaluation of the devices condition and value by Trade In-platform.
